Lot 60                1950s Beistle 3-D Scarecrow Fold-Out Decoration (BOOK ITEM)
Beistle made a trio of these cleverly designed fold-out table decorations during the mid-1950s. This is the scarecrow scene. The fold-out sections at the base are typically in poor shape and often have been repaired in some way, typically with staples or tape. Thankfully, this example has avoided that fate. There is a soft bend where the scarecrow’s hand meets the moon’s perimeter. It measures ~8” high by ~7.75” wide. This is the very item photographed for my reference books. It appears on page 231 of the third edition. This entered the collection on June 1, 1995.
